The global Brushless DC Electrical Oil Pump market size was estimated at USD 602 million in 2024 and is projected to reach USD 1682.86 million by 2032, exhibiting a CAGR of 12.10% during the forecast period.
North America Brushless DC Electrical Oil Pump market size was estimated at USD 191.09 million in 2024, at a CAGR of 10.37% during the forecast period of 2025 through 2032.

Electrical Oil Pumps (EOP) are mainly used in all types of transmissions (Automatic Transmission – AT, dry or wet Dual Clutch Transmission – DCT, Dedicated Hybrid Transmission – DHT, Continuous Variable Transmission – CVT, Manual Transmission – MT, reducer) for lubrication and cooling (gears, clutches, eDrive) and in a lower proportion also for actuation (of clutches, hydraulic gear shifting, hydraulic park-lock).

4. What is a brushless DC electrical oil pump?
Â
Â
Â
- A brushless DC electrical oil pump is a compact, energy-efficient pump powered by a brushless DC motor. It is primarily used in automotive and industrial applications for oil circulation and lubrication without mechanical commutation.
